    I titled it this way because I did not purchase my first materials with my OWN money. I truly had $0 of my own money. I went to a local credit union and got a credit card with a $2,000 limit on. To start this business I leveraged other peoples money (the banks money). Before buying ladders I went out spent $20 on fliers put those out, got about 8 calls that first week, 6 people accepted my bids then once they accepted the bid I went out and bought that ladder, the brush, soap, towels, spray bottle and squeegee all on credit. With the profits from 2 of the houses I was able to pay off that credit balance within days. So yes this is a business that I started with money however I started it with $0 of my own personal money and instead leveraged someone else money.     I’ve never brought my own water unless working on a new build home without access to water. In those situations I bring 5 gallon buckets with caps filled with water. Otherwise my clients have never minded if I use their hose to fill up my buckets.
